Thiruvananthapuram: BJP state president K. Surendran has criticized the incident of making a fake application to win the Youth Congress organizational election. The fake identity card was created by the Youth Congress using a mobile application called CR Card. BJP state president K. Surendran said that a case should be registered as soon as possible and that a Congress MLA is behind the crime.
“The use of fake election ID card for Youth Congress elections is a serious criminal offence. It can be used in general elections, make fake SIM cards and many other scams can be done through it. This app is made under the direct guidance of an MLA. KC Venugopal and VD Satheesan knew about this. The police should file a case immediately. The Election Commission should also intervene,” said K. Surendran. He also said that BJP will take appropriate legal action in this regard.
It was earlier reported that many Youth Congress activists cast their votes in their organizational election by preparing fake identity cards of the Election Commission of India. It is also alarming that only a passport size photograph is required to make an Election Commission ID card. If you provide information including name and address, the fake card will be available through the app within 5 minutes to beat the original ID card. Thousands of election identification cards were produced by the Youth Congress in this way.
